Most of the population accepts that climate change is real. Most want to do something about it. But what shall we ask them to do? And what’s the best way to elicit a response? Recently the EECA, the Energy Efficiency and Conservation Authority, released an updated version of their survey into attitudes towards climate change.
The results show that who you are, where you live, and what you earn dictate what you believe and how much you’re prepared to do support climate action. Vincent is joined by Jo Bye, GM of marketing and communications at EECA.
